Talebook features and specs

  • Design Process: Customize the design process for your project needs.
  • Surveys: Create simple surveys
  • Tags: Analyze data and create themes with tags.
  • Interactive Templates: Get inspired with unique interactive templates.
  • Personas: Group target users based on similar criteria in Personas.
